Research Vision

My research focuses on human-state-aware robot partner systems for smart living and assistive robotics. I study how robots and intelligent systems can estimate users’ attention, intention, interest, hesitation, and support needs from multimodal nonverbal information such as gaze, gesture, posture, and contextual information.

The goal of my research is to develop human-centric robotic systems that can provide adaptive support in daily living environments, smart homes, healthcare, education, and mobility assistance.
